用datediff求時間段
鄭志武
發(fā)布于2013-03-01 23:32
56
0
標簽:
求一個時間段的秒數(shù),改了很久,就是不成功,懇請各位大俠指點下,代碼如下
dimtz,sj,zero,jl
zero=hmiruntime.tags("zero_tag").read
jl=hmiruntime.tags("jl_tag").read
ifzero=1then
hmiruntime.tags("zero_tag").write0
hmiruntime.tags("qs_time").writecstr(now)
qs=cstr(now)
endif
ifjl=1andzero=0then
hmiruntime.tags("tz_time").writecstr(now)
tz=cstr(now)
hmiruntime.tags("sj").writecstr(datediff("s",qs,tz))
endif
我就求很短的一段時間,為什么所用時間那么大呀,我的輸出格式都是字符串
圖片說明: 1,例圖
佳答案
問題出在變量qs,當jl=1時,qs沒有被賦值,datediff函數(shù)里的qs應該用讀取變量qs_time的值來代替。